Astrolabes are models of the universe that you can hold in your hand. They allow you to predict the positions of stars, planets, and the sun based on the time of day and year. You can also use them to determine the time by observing the positions of the stars.
This Astrolabes is one I created using a laser etcher. It is based the software created by [Richard Wymarc's Astrolabe Project](http://www.astrolabeproject.com), and there are detailed instructions about how to build it in my [Instructables - How to Build a Customized Astrolabe](https://www.instructables.com/id/How-to-Build-a-Customized-Astrolabe-Using-a-Laser-/) project.
I've included all the files. If you want to get started, just try etching the mini_astrolabe.ai file on a single 11x14 piece of acrylic. The avery_circle templates are for putting color inset sheets between the clear acrylic. Again, take a look at the Instructable for details.
